Output 3ccb1e815b29145faef4b4c97f7447c2dcd4daba0fb8bc8b38b356e6ce38a2d0:0

value
17071321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c75c962e445300e552b8c588f0baa81b1b9db58 OP_EQUAL
address
3EVhdMtcRT5AV8P3WiPM7yGwrDLsGaNsfB
transaction
3ccb1e815b29145faef4b4c97f7447c2dcd4daba0fb8bc8b38b356e6ce38a2d0
spent
true